White Plains, NY (January 2014)  The
Hudson Gateway Association of REALTORS® is proud to welcome Diane Cummins,
Branch Manager of Douglas Elliman Real Estate in Katonah, as its 2014 President ,and J. Philip Faranda, owner and principal broker of J.
Philip Real Estate LLC in Briarcliff
Manor, as the President of its subsidiary,
the Hudson Gateway Multiple Listing Service. (HGMLS).

Cummins
and Faranda, along with the executive officers and directors of HGAR and HGMLS
were officially installed in their new positions at the Association’s Gala
2014, held recently at The View in Piermont. 
More than 250 Realtors from Westchester, Putnam, Rockland and Orange
counties attended the event.

Cummins has been a broker in the
Westchester area for almost 30 years. 
Prior to her real estate career, she spent 15 years as a theatrical
agent in New York City representing clients such as Tom Cruise in film, TV and
Broadway ventures. 



 



Cummins was recognized as the Putnam
County Realtor of the Year in 2000, 2002 and 2005. She is the past president of
the former Putnam Association of Realtors (serving for 4 years); 2006
Chairwoman of the New York State International Committee; and the NAR
President’s Liaison to the Bulgarian Real Estate Association, from 2006 to
2011.



 



She is also a Graduate of the Real Estate
Institute (GRI), Certified International Property Specialist (CIPS), Accredited
Buyer Representative (ABR), holds a Transnational Referral Certification (TRC)
and is a Certified NYS Real Estate instructor. Her most recent accomplishments
include receiving her certification as a NAR mediator and her acceptance into
The Mayflower Descendant's Society.



 



Faranda founded his own firm in 2005, which today is one of
the leading independent brokerages in Westchester.  Faranda has appeared on ABC World News and
been a source for the New York Times, Businessweek, the Associated Press,
MSNBC, The New York Post, Gannett, AOL, The Real Deal, TheStreet.com,
1010Wins.com, Smart Money, MSN Money, Time.com, and various other media outlets. 



An industry veteran since 1996, he is one of the
top-selling broker agents for transaction totals in Westchester County since
2007. He is also a director for the New York Association of Realtors (NYSAR)
and 2014 chair of the NYSAR Technology Forum. In 2012 he was among 20 agents
selected nationwide to be on Zillow.com's Agent Advisory Board and he is a 2013
finalist for the Inman News Innovator Award.   He is also the author of the
Westchester Real Estate Blog and the New York Short Sale Blog.



 



Cummins
succeeds Katheryn DeClerck of BHG Rand in Warwick, the 2013 HGAR President, and Faranda takes over the reins
from Russ Woolley of Wright Bros Real Estate Inc in Nyack, the 2013 HGMLS President. 
DeClerck and Woolley will remain on the Executive Committees of HGAR and
HGMLS respectively.

The
Hudson Gateway Association of REALTORS® (HGAR) is a not-for-profit trade association covering over 9,000
real estate professionals doing business in Westchester, Putnam, Rockland, and
Orange counties.   HGAR is comprised of
the former Westchester Putnam Association of REALTORS® (WPAR), Rockland County Board of REALTORS® (RCBR) and Orange County Association of
REALTORS® (OCAR). 



 



The
Hudson Gateway Multiple Listing Service (HGMLS), owned by HGAR, offers some
24,000 properties in the Bronx, Westchester, Putnam, Dutchess, Rockland,
Orange, Sullivan and Ulster counties. It is among the top 50 largest MLSs in
the country.
